Types of Jobs Available at Pick n Pay

These roles represent some of the diverse opportunities at Pick n Pay, ranging from entry-level positions to highly specialized or managerial roles. Each position offers unique pathways for career growth within the company.

Here are some common job positions available at Pick n Pay, categorized by department or area of work:

#1. Pick n Pay Retail & Store Jobs

These customer-facing roles ensure smooth store operations and excellent service delivery.

Store Managers & Supervisors – Oversee store performance, manage staff, and drive sales.

Cashiers – Process customer transactions and provide friendly service at checkout.

Shelf Packers & Merchandisers – Ensure shelves are stocked and displays are well-maintained.

Customer Service Assistants – Assist shoppers with inquiries, complaints, and returns.

Deli, Bakery & Butchery Staff – Prepare and serve fresh food products.
#2. Pick n Pay Warehouse & Distribution Jobs

Pick n Pay’s supply chain network relies on warehouses and logistics teams to keep stores stocked.

  • Warehouse Assistants – Handle inventory, sort stock, and prepare orders.
  • Forklift Operators – Move heavy stock within the warehouse.
  • Truck Drivers & Delivery Personnel – Transport goods from distribution centers to stores.
  • Inventory Controllers – Manage stock levels and coordinate deliveries.

#3. Corporate & Administrative Jobs

These roles support Pick n Pay’s business operations from its head offices.

  • Finance & Accounting – Handle budgets, payroll, and financial planning.
  • Marketing & Advertising – Promote Pick n Pay’s products and brand.
  • Human Resources (HR) – Manage recruitment, employee benefits, and training.
  • IT & Digital Solutions – Support e-commerce, cybersecurity, and data management.

General Requirements for Pick n Pay Jobs

While specific roles may have unique qualifications, there are general requirements that apply to most jobs at Pick n Pay:

  • Minimum Education: A Grade 12 certificate (Matric) is typically required for entry-level positions. Higher qualifications may be necessary for specialized or corporate roles.
  • Experience: Relevant work experience is an advantage but not always mandatory for entry-level jobs.
  • Skills:
    • Strong communication and interpersonal skills
    • Ability to work in a team
    • Customer service orientation
    • Attention to detail and problem-solving abilities
  • Availability: Flexibility to work shifts, weekends, and public holidays.
  • Legal Requirements:
    • Must be legally authorized to work in South Africa.
    • A valid ID or work permit is required.
  • Physical Fitness: Some roles, such as shelf packing and forklift operation, may require physical stamina.
